The Big Announcement!!!!!!!!!

It is my pleasure to announce the opening of my new studio in downtown Philadelphia! Two years ago this month, I started this business because my love for photography grew along with our newborn daughter.  She gave me the desire to stop time with photographs. As a mom, I know I am not alone in this area.  We all want to stop time.  We all want to look back and remember those little smiles, tiny toes and curly locks!  It literally brings tears to my eyes as I write this...my passion has become capturing those memories for as many parents as I can.  It's my life's gift, my love. 


As my passion grew, so did my business.  Thanks to you, I had a full calendar in my first year and an overbooked one in the second.  I opened a small studio in my home in the second year and it became apparent rather quickly that I would outgrow it.  My husband and I  talked and talked about how to expand.  What would be best?  A home addition? While driving through town one February afternoon (headed to pick up my little one from daycare), I noticed a chair on the sidewalk at our local antique mall.  Always a sucker for a chair with good bones and potential, I stopped to purchase it.  When I got out of the car, I noticed construction workers hard at work renovating a building three doors down.  I will admit, I had driven by the building every day heading to the daycare and often thought what a great studio space it would be!  At the counter, I asked what the plans were for the space, who owned it, etc. I mean, this is a small town, we are all nosy, right? The owner proceeded to tell me that the building was being renovated--no tenant, no plans.  As fast as I could, I asked the rent price range.  Wouldn't you know, there sat the perfect space with no tenant and the perfect rent!  WOW!  How's that for a coincidental shopping trip?  By the way, the chair was only $15, and I had it recovered and it looks fab! Ok, back to the big picture...


I have always felt that God had His hand in my business.  I feel His spirit leading me and sending me some of the most amazing clients!  My success thus far is all because of Him!  So, this is a bit of a leap of faith, but it feels right and I am so excited about the opportunity!  I know that this is right where I need to be.  And sometimes, the days are long and the nights are longer owning a business and doing it all on my own. But when a mom comes by to pick up her prints and literally cries tears of joy in the foyer of my home, I know this plan of His is just right for me!  At that moment it comes full circle and I have accomplished more than what I set out to do. 


An opening date has not been set as we are waiting on the building renovations to be complete.  We are tentatively scheduled for late spring 2012.  I hope that you will take the opportunity to stop by and tour our new space when it's open!  And by all means, get on the calendar...this will be a studio experience like no other:)  The 2000 square foot boutique studio features a natural light studio along with 6 studio bays and a client viewing gallery.
